Croatia and Belgium drew without any goals in the third match of Group F. A result good enough to qualify the team captained by Modrić for the round of 16 for and did not help the Courtois and Hazard’s Belgium to continue in the World Cup. However, both the Croatian midfielder and the Belgian goalkeeper played the full 90, while Hazard was subbed in the second half.
Croatia, who finished second in the group behind Morocco, will play in the round of 16 against the leading team from Group E, which will be drawn from one of the following four teams: Spain, Japan, Costa Rica or Germany. The match will be played on Monday, December 5th, at 4pm (CET). Belgium, meanwhile, has ended its World Cup campaign third with a balance of one win, one draw and one loss.
